A nurse is ambulating a client who suddenly feels faint and starts to fall. Which of these actions should the nurse take FIRST?

a. Check the client's blood pressure.
b. Call for help.
c. Ease the client to the floor.
d. Hold the client upright until a chair is available.


C
Gait belts provide client safety when ambulating. If a client suddenly feels faint and starts to fall, ease the client to the floor while supporting and protecting the head.
